The Benefits Of Having A Piano Tutor For Kids

Learning how to play the piano is a rewarding and enriching experience for children. Not only does it promote musical development, but it also enhances cognitive skills, discipline, and creativity. However, practicing on their own can be challenging for young learners. This is where a piano tutor for kids comes in to provide guidance and support throughout their musical journey.

Here are some of the benefits of having a piano tutor for kids:

1. Personalized Instruction – One of the main advantages of having a piano tutor for kids is the personalized instruction they receive. A tutor can tailor their teaching methods to suit each child’s learning style and pace, ensuring that they progress at a comfortable rate. This individualized approach helps children stay engaged and motivated, leading to faster improvement and a deeper understanding of the instrument.

2. Proper Technique – Learning the correct technique is crucial when playing the piano. A tutor can demonstrate and explain the proper hand position, posture, and finger movement to prevent bad habits from forming. By having a piano tutor for kids, children can develop a strong foundation in technique from the very beginning, setting them up for success as they advance to more challenging pieces.

3. Accountability – Consistency is key when learning how to play an instrument. A piano tutor for kids can help hold children accountable for their practice sessions and progress. By setting goals and deadlines, tutors can motivate children to practice regularly and strive for continuous improvement. This accountability factor encourages discipline and responsibility in young learners, skills that can benefit them in various areas of their lives.

4. Encouragement and Support – Learning to play the piano can be both exciting and challenging for children. Having a piano tutor provides them with the encouragement and support they need to navigate through any obstacles they may encounter. Tutors can offer constructive feedback, praise accomplishments, and provide motivation during times of frustration. This positive reinforcement helps children build confidence in their abilities and fosters a love for music that can last a lifetime.

5. Supplemental Learning – In addition to weekly lessons, a piano tutor for kids can also provide supplemental learning materials to enhance their musical education. Tutors may recommend books, sheet music, apps, or online resources that can reinforce the concepts learned in lessons. These additional materials can help children practice independently, explore new genres of music, and expand their musical knowledge beyond what is taught in their regular lessons.

6. Fun and Creative Learning Environment – A piano tutor for kids can create a fun and creative learning environment that is conducive to learning. Tutors often incorporate games, activities, and improvisation exercises into their lessons to make learning enjoyable and engaging for children. By making music fun and interactive, tutors can ignite children’s passion for playing the piano and nurture their creativity and expression through music.

7. Performance Opportunities – Another benefit of having a piano tutor for kids is the opportunity to participate in recitals, competitions, and other performance events. Tutors can help prepare children for these performances by selecting appropriate repertoire, practicing stage presence, and instilling confidence in their abilities. Performing in front of an audience can boost self-esteem, improve stage fright, and showcase children’s progress and talent to friends and family.

In conclusion, having a piano tutor for kids can greatly enhance their musical development and overall learning experience. From personalized instruction and proper technique to accountability and support, tutors play a vital role in guiding children through their musical journey. By creating a fun and creative learning environment and providing opportunities for performance, piano tutors help children reach their full potential as pianists and musicians.
